The Hartford Dispensary, founded in 1871, is a leading behavioral healthcare provider dedicated to treating substance abuse and addiction. Accredited by CARF for its high standards of care, the Hartford Dispensary seeks out passionate and talented individuals to join its staff. Regardless of the position held, each employee plays an important role in caring for patients and providing support in their recovery. Today, the Hartford Dispensary is one of the largest provider of methadone treatment in the country. The agency treats over 5,000 patients per day within its network of nine statewide clinics.

Position Summary
The Director of Clinical Services is responsible for planning, implementation and supervision for all clinical and counseling services across multiple locations. Oversees implementation of new programs and services, chairperson of the Quality Improvement Committee, agency Fair Hearing Officer, liaison with external agencies, oversees education and training of clinical staff, member of the Policy, Procedure, and Forms Committee, and member of the Corporate Compliance Committee.
Education, Licensure & Experience
Graduate degree in social work, psychology or allied science with a current and valid license in the state of Connecticut as an LCSW or LPC. The applicant should have at least six years of full time paid experience in the behavioral health treatment field, preferably in the area of substance abuse, and at least five years of administrative experience.
